Pairing Thorque with Other Fonts for Visual Harmony

Font pairing is essential for any designer or maker, and Thorque plays well with others. I often pair it with a clean sans serif like Montserrat or a simple serif like Playfair Display. This contrast helps balance the flowing script with more structured typography, making the overall design feel cohesive and professional.

If you’re creating product packaging, social media graphics, or printable wall art, try using Thorque for headlines and a simpler font for supporting text. This technique works especially well for boutique tags, seasonal signs, and branding materials where readability and emotional appeal matter.

What to Know Before Using Thorque in Commercial Projects

Before using Thorque for your handmade shop or digital product line, always check the licensing terms. Many commercial fonts require a license for selling physical or digital products. Make sure the version you download allows for commercial use, especially if you’re creating SVG files, printables, or branded packaging.

Also, check if the font includes alternates, ligatures, or swashes that might enhance your design. Some handwritten fonts offer stylistic variations that can make your text feel even more authentic. If you’re using cutting machines like Cricut or Silhouette, test the font at small sizes to ensure readability on stickers, tags, and labels.
